Worker interest in joining a union is at its highest in decades — public support for unions in the U.S. is as high as it was in 1965.
Urged on by a new generation of labor leaders, many workers see unionization as a way to make their companies better.

In a powerful show of solidarity, SAG-AFTRA members have voted 97.91% in favor of a strike authorization ahead of negotiations of the TV/Theatrical Contracts, with nearly 65,000 members casting ballots for a voting percentage of 47.69% of eligible voters.
